Where do you fit in?
We're looking for a Senior Smart Contract Engineer to join our team. You'll have an opportunity to work across our entire Ethereum-based web3 stack on cutting-edge technology that reshapes the global financial system.

RESPONSIBILITIES
*** Protocol Architecture:** Research and develop protocol upgrades and new financial contracts
*** Smart Contracts:** Implement designs with a focus on security, simplicity, ease of use, and gas-efficiency
*** Software Development:** Implement, test, and audit open-source software that is used to interact with on-chain smart contracts; plan to ship something new every two weeks
*** Smart Contract Systems:** write off-chain code to interact with and manage smart contracts. Thrive in an iterative and collaborative shipment environment

SKILLS & QUALIFICATIONS

  • 2+ years full-time experience in Engineering at a software or financial services technology organization
  • 1+ years full-time experience working in solidity
  • Demonstrated ability to learn new tech and write secure and high quality code
  • Passion for blockchain technology, cryptonomic protocol design, game theory, and decentralized finance

Our tech stack: Solidity, Javascript, Typescript, Node.js, web3, ethers, hardhat, React
